Functional Description
7
T1/E1
E1 mode selection.
when this bit is
one, the device is in E1 mode.
6-5
RSV
Reserved.
Must be kept at 0 for
normal operation.
4
LIUEn
LIU Enable.
Setting this bit low
enables the internal LIU front-end.
Setting this pin high disables the
LIU. Digital inputs RXA and RXB are
sampled by the rising edge of E2.0i
(C1.50) to strobe in the received line
data. Digital transmit data is clocked
out of pins TXA and TXB with the
rising edge of C2.0o
3
ELOS
ELOS Enable.
Set this bit low to set
the analog loss of signal threshold to
40 dB below nominal. Set this bit
high to set the analog loss of signal
threshold to 20 dB below nominal.
2
RSV
Reserved.
Must be kept at 0 for
normal operation.
1
ADSEQ
Digital Milliwatt or Digital Test
Sequence
. If one, the A-law digital
milliwatt analog test sequence will
be selected by the Per Time Slot
Control bits TTST and RTST.If zero,
a PRBS generator / detector will be
connected to channels with TTST,
RRST respectively
0
RSV
Reserved.
Must be kept at 0 for
normal operation.
Table 96 - Configuration Control Word
(Page 2, Address 10H) (E1)
